Transaction 653063abe2b0bb1ea67b8eae746159a83e654dbd1898bd64e1104d2614c6fbba
1 Input
1 Output
-
653063abe2b0bb1ea67b8eae746159a83e654dbd1898bd64e1104d2614c6fbba:0
- value
- 10636044
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 869a39df10d08127b3682d1003d6c28976106c4f OP_EQUAL
- address
- 3DxjE4dzVz8r7zcBHsaWXsfBFTA5hvaWbC